I'm excited to share my first design attempt in Tinkercad, a replacement shower door handle that's easy to make and assemble. Please note that you'll need to adjust the bolt holes' distance according to your needs. This project requires just two simple parts: a 25mm M6 hex head bolt and nut. You'll also need some basic tools like a drill press or hand drill for assembly. Printing at 40% infill ensures durability without sacrificing too much weight. To assemble, simply insert the bolts into the pre-drilled holes and secure them with nuts. Make sure they're tightened firmly to avoid any movement during use.
